What is your favorite type of art to create?

My favourite type of art to create is art with hidden meanings. I love to paint with acrylic and oil on canvas sharing secret messages, words, and symbolism hidden throughout.

Where do you find inspiration?

In my day to day life. My past. My future desires, dreams, and goals.

What would you do with $25,000?

I would purchase new art tools/equipment to improve my productivity and creativity. I would also use it to live a little more fully because with experience, comes ideas, creativity, and growth.
